Last Seen Alive
By Carlene ThompsonChyna Greer was sixteen when her best friend, Zoey, disappeared. Though very different in looks and temperament, the two girls shared a bond that was stronger than blood. But even Chyna's urgent warnings couldn't prevent a love-struck Zoey from sneaking out to the lake to meet her secret crush - and being swallowed up into the warm summer night forever...Now Chyna has come back to her West Virginia hometown of Black Willow to lay her mother to rest. But memories of Zoey are everywhere...and then, out of nowhere, Chyna hears a voice - Zoey's voice - begging for her help. As Chyna delves into Black Willow's past, she learns that two other teenagers also went missing. Soon Chyna's search for answers becomes a desperate race to uncover a chilling secret that strikes at the heart of everything she holds dear - and reveal the remorseless evil that has been hiding in plain sight...
